A Brief History

The Magic Fountain was built in 1929 for the International Exhibition held in Barcelona. Designed by the engineer Carles Buïgas, the fountain was initially met with skepticism. However, it quickly became a beloved landmark and a symbol of the city. Over the years, the fountain has undergone several renovations and improvements to enhance its beauty and performance.

Planning Your Visit

The Magic Fountain performances are free of charge and take place on select evenings throughout the year. The schedule varies depending on the season, so it’s essential to check the official website or local listings for the most up-to-date information.

It’s best to arrive early to secure a good viewing spot, especially during peak tourist seasons. You can bring a blanket or a folding chair to make yourself comfortable while you enjoy the show. Don’t forget your camera or smartphone to capture the magical moments and create lasting memories.
